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-71330

Implement the activity dates functionality for mod_chat and output them in view.php

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ide

      should pass phpunit and behat tests

      1. Create a new chat module, in `Chat sessions` settings, choose "Next chat time" in the future, "Repeat/publish session times", choose "No repeats - publish the specified time only"
      2. go back to chat view page, should see "Next chat time 21 April 2021, 8:55 pm"
      3. go to chat settings, update next chat time to a date in the past and "Repeat/publish session times", choose "At the same time every day"
      4. go back to chat view page, should see next chat time in the future
      5. go to chat settings, update next chat time to a date in the past and "Repeat/publish session times", choose "At the same time every week"
      6. go back to chat view page, should see next chat time in the future

       

      Show
      should pass phpunit and behat tests Create a new chat module, in `Chat sessions` settings, choose "Next chat time" in the future, "Repeat/publish session times", choose "No repeats - publish the specified time only" go back to chat view page, should see "Next chat time 21 April 2021, 8:55 pm" go to chat settings, update next chat time to a date in the past and "Repeat/publish session times", choose "At the same time every day" go back to chat view page, should see next chat time in the future go to chat settings, update next chat time to a date in the past and "Repeat/publish session times", choose "At the same time every week" go back to chat view page, should see next chat time in the future  
    • Affected Branches:
      MOODLE_311_STABLE
    • Fixed Branches:
      MOODLE_311_STABLE
    • Pull from Repository:
    • Pull 3.11 Branch:
      MDL-71330-311
    • Pull Master Branch:
      MDL-71330-master

      Description

      Following MDL-70818, we need to implement the activity dates functionality for the chat module as well.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              dongsheng Dongsheng Cai
              Reporter:
              rezaie9 Shamim Rezaie
              Peer reviewer:
              Huong Nguyen Huong Nguyen
              Integrator:
              Jun Pataleta Jun Pataleta
              Tester:
              Gladys Basiana Gladys Basiana
              Participants:
              Component watchers:
              Sam Marshall,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Ilya Tregubov, Sara Arjona (@sarjona)
              Votes:
              0 Vote for this issue
              Watchers:
              9 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                17/May/21

                  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 1 day, 3 hours, 35 minutes
                  1d 3h 35m